From: Feiyang Chen <chenfeiyang@loongson.cn>
Expose module parameters so that we can use them in specific device
configurations. Add the 'stmmac_' prefix for them to avoid conflicts.
Meanwhile, there was a 'buf_sz' local variable in stmmac_rx() with the
same name as the global variable, and now we can distinguish them.
Signed-off-by: Feiyang Chen <chenfeiyang@loongson.cn>
---
drivers/net/ethernet/stmicro/stmmac/stmmac.h | 11 ++
.../net/ethernet/stmicro/stmmac/stmmac_main.c | 117 +++++++++---------
2 files changed, 70 insertions(+), 58 deletions(-)

From: Feiyang Chen <chenfeiyang@loongson.cn>
Current dwmac-loongson only support LS2K in the "probed with PCI and
configured with DT" manner. We add LS7A support on which the devices
are fully PCI (non-DT).
Signed-off-by: Huacai Chen <chenhuacai@loongson.cn>
Signed-off-by: Feiyang Chen <chenfeiyang@loongson.cn>
---
.../ethernet/stmicro/stmmac/dwmac-loongson.c | 177 ++++++++++++------
1 file changed, 124 insertions(+), 53 deletions(-)
